Paris Saint Germain coach Christophe Galtier has refused to comment when asked if there will be more attempts from PSG to sign Inter’s Milan Skriniar, according to a report in the Italian media. 

As has been reported FCInternews today, the French coach spoke to the press ahead of his side’s Ligue 1 clash this weekend.

They have been linked all summer long with a move for the Slovakian centre-back and had multiple approaches turned down by the Nerazzurri because they did not meet the asking price that the Nerazzurri have set.

The player was then taken off the market in the second half of August as Inter do not want to lose a key player that they can’t replace so close to the start of the season.

The latest links now suggest that the French champions will be trying to sign him on a free transfer next summer by convincing him not to renew with Inter.

When asked, Christophe Galtier said: “I will not comment.”
